How Is Lasik Eye Surgery Done


Before LASIK, your physician will take a full case history as well as ophthalmic examination. It is essential to obtain an accurate picture of your eye, since any irregularities can create problems. Wavefront-guided modern technology will develop a comprehensive graph of your eye, which boosts the precision of the treatment. During your consultation, your medical professional will certainly also discuss your risk factors as well as respond to any questions you may have. If you are a candidate, your medical professional will certainly discuss the treatment to you, and also respond to all of your inquiries.

The major components of LASIK are an accuracy femtosecond laser as well as a microkeratome. https://drive.google.com/drive/folders/1MNeF3sDbaLdAMdN20XeHBAIV9qGqZZ7k?usp=drive_open will certainly produce a slim flap externally of your cornea using a microkeratome, as well as use an excimer laser to get rid of a small amount of cells from the internal cornea. These laser pulses will deal with the cornea's curvature and allow images to focus on the retina. After the procedure, the flap will reattach, and also the recovery process will start.

The whole procedure will certainly take no greater than a few mins per eye. The cosmetic surgeon will certainly make use of an excimer laser to form your cornea and also restore your vision.
